Grout waterproofing services involve applying specialized sealants or coatings to the grout lines between tiles, primarily in areas prone to moisture exposure such as bathrooms, kitchens, basements, and laundry rooms. This process helps create a barrier that prevents water from seeping through the grout and reaching underlying surfaces. Proper waterproofing not only maintains the appearance of tiled surfaces but also extends their lifespan by reducing the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by persistent moisture infiltration.

Many common problems can be addressed with grout waterproofing services. Over time, grout lines can develop cracks, become porous, or deteriorate due to regular use and exposure to moisture. These issues can lead to water leakage, staining, and the growth of mold or mildew, which can be difficult to eliminate once established. Waterproofing helps mitigate these risks by sealing the grout, preventing water from penetrating behind tiles, and maintaining the integrity of the tiled surfaces. This service is particularly beneficial for properties experiencing recurring moisture issues or those preparing for renovations to ensure long-lasting results.

What is grout waterproofing? Grout waterproofing involves applying a sealant or membrane to grout lines to prevent water penetration and reduce damage caused by moisture.

Why is grout waterproofing important for my home? It helps protect walls and floors from water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by moisture seeping through grout lines.

How do local contractors perform grout waterproofing? They typically clean the grout surface, apply a specialized sealant or membrane, and ensure proper coverage to prevent water infiltration.

Can grout waterproofing be done on existing tiles? Yes, experienced service providers can seal existing grout lines to improve water resistance without removing tiles.

What types of waterproofing products are used by local service providers? They often use penetrating sealants, membrane coatings, or epoxy-based products designed for durability and effective water protection.
